Study On The Different Turnover Time Interval In The Patients With Different Weight Using Air Bed

Objective:Under the premise of without increasing the incidence of pressure ulcers, By thenursing methods of prolonging rolling over interva step by step, monitoring changesof the skin temperature and surface pressure value different time in main pressureparts of patients with the air cushion bed, exploring the differences of differentweight patients in different rolling over time interval.Methods:With the self-control study,selecting77patients who can’t change positionindependently and willing to join in this study from neurology randomly. Dividedinto low weight, normal weight, overweight according to body mass index. Usingself-designed questionnaire in patients with general information collection; Using the“Braden pressure sores forecasting” estimating pressure ulcer risk factors; Markingthe implementation of rolling over with a homemade "Turn over records". Byextending the rolling over time interval (extend30minutes every stage, extended to4hours/day)step by step to caring patients in air cushion bed, measured and recordedsurface pressure and skin temperature for2hours,2.5hours,3hours and3.5hours,4hours in patients about sacral rear and sides shoulder blade.Results:1.The patients of the skin appears abnormal in the research object is6,7.79℅.2.In the low weight group, compared with body surface pressure of both sides ofthe shoulder and sacral rear in patients using air cushion bed, rolling over in differenttime interval, with the extension of turnaround time interval, the pressure changes ofthe body surface has no significant difference (P>0.05) and the average values ofbody pressure was statistically significant (P <0.05) in sacral rear and both sides of the shoulder blades in the same turn time interval.3.In the low weight group, compared with the surface temperature on both sidesof the shoulder blade and the sacral in patients using air cushion bed rolling over atdifferent time interval, finding the result of surface temperature changes were nosignificant difference (P>0.05) with the extension of turnaround time interval, Theaverage temperature value is statistically significant (P <0.05) n the same turn timeinterval on sacral rear and both sides of the shoulder blades.4.In the normal weight group,the change of the surface pressure was nosignificant difference (P>0.05)on both sides of the shoulder blade area and sacralwtih rolling over in different time interval. The average values of body pressure wasstatistically significant (P <0.05)in the same turn time interval on sacral rear and bothsides of the shoulder blades.5.In the normal weight group, the surface temperature changes have nosignificant difference (P>0.05) with the extension of turnaround time interval,rollingover in different time interval on both sides of the shoulder blade and the sacral.6.No obvious difference of the pressure (P>0.05) on the body surface is found asthe turnover interval prolongs, through the comparison of the pressure on the scapulaand the sacrum when overweight patients turn over in the air bed after differentintervals.7. There is notable difference in shell temperature after lying on back for4hours(P>0.05) as the turnover interval prolongs, through comparison of the shelltemperature on the scapula and the sacrum when overweight patients turn over inthe air bed after different intervals.8. It is found in the research that the gradual prolongation of interval is aneffective way to reduce the pain and discomfort caused by turning over, so that thesleep quality can be improved (P <0.05).Conclusions:1. The use of air bed has the effect of reducing the pressure on the main pressedareas. The method of gradual prolongation of turnover interval has the same effect ofpreventing pressure sores with the traditional turning-body-over methods. 2. There is difference in the turnover intervals for patients of different weight whenthey use air beds. Patients who are underweight can turn their body over once as longas every3hours, while those who are overweight or of normal weight every4hours.3. The gradual prolongation of turnover interval has certain promotion valuebecause it can decrease the frequency of turning over, raise comfort level as well asreduce the workload of nursing staff.
